Higginsville then and now
Side-by-side ABS Census comparison for Higginsville, WA (postcode 6443) — how the suburb looked across Census years from 2011 to 2021.
Population
Census 2016 → 2021
-71.2% over 5 years
| Metric | 2011 | 2016 | 2021 | Change (→2021)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Population | — | 66 | 19 | -47 · -71.2% |
| Median age | 35 | 33 | 47 | +12 · +34.3% |
| Median household income | $1,036/wk | — | $3,750/wk | +$2,714 · +262% |
| Median personal income | $1,315/wk | $1,981/wk | $2,187/wk | +$872 · +66.3% |
| Median rent | $60/wk | — | $380/wk | +$320 · +533.3% |
| Median mortgage | $909/mo | — | $0/mo | $909 · -100% |
| Average household size | 3.0 | — | 2.0 | -1 · -33.3% |
Change is measured from the earliest available Census year to 2021 for each metric.
